2015-10-09 4 views
1

Я использую Дженкинс, чтобы построить свой веб-сайт AngularJS и развернуть его на ведро S3, и я также использую filerev задачу через Grunt. Я использую this plugin для развертывания от Дженкинса до ведра, но когда статический ресурс переименовывается через filerevпри создании веб-сайта он не удаляется из ведра.Удалить переименованные файлы из-за filerev от S3 ведра

Я не хочу использовать атрибут Object Expiration S3, я просто хочу удалить устаревшие ресурсы после развертывания. Благодаря!

+0

какая версия угловых? –

ответ

0

У меня нет возможности проверить это, но я предлагаю вам попробовать удалить файлы из вашего ведра S3, добавив шаг Execute shell и используя командную строку AWS.
Вы можете найти, как это сделать в this answer или в официальном Amazon Documentation. После удаления всего, вы можете развернуть новую версию своего приложения с помощью плагина Jenkins.

Смежные вопросы